Table 2 Co-integration results using the Phillips-Ouliaris (PO) test between daily infection data and daily death data with a positive seven-day lag in the FW time period. The null hypothesis indicates that there is no co-integration, and we use a 95% confidence level. DD* represents Death Data with a positive lag of seven days. Note: a – represents statistically significant co-integration in FW; b – represents statistically significant co-integration in TW1; c – represents statistically significant co-integration in TW2; d – represents statistically significant co-integration in TW3

From: A data-driven approach to study temporal characteristics of COVID-19 infection and death Time Series for twelve countries across six continents
